Microwave reactions of 2, 5-bis-trifluoromethyl-1, 3, 4-oxadiazole with norbornenes
2009The reactions of 2, 5-bis-trifluoromethyl-1, 3, 4- oxadiazole 2 with norbornenes [1] under microwave conditions were investigated. MW reactions enabled the reaction times and temperatures to be significantly reduced, as compared to classical thermal reactions.

1,3,4-oxadiazoles, heterocycles bearing one oxygen and two nitrogen atoms in a five membered ring have their application in the diverse areas of medicine.[1] This interesting group of compounds has diverse biological activities such as antibacterial, antifungal, antiviral, anticonvulsant, anticancer, anti-inflammatory, anti HIV, anti-tubercular ...
